Thirteen year old girl stunning weightlifting records
Abbey Watson is a thirteen year old girl from Colorado who’s smashing records by lifting weights. She has broken 28 US records including eight world records in powerlifting

Lucky tourist survives after bungee cord snaps
Erin Langworthy seems to be the luckiest woman alive after her bungee cord snaps and she plunged into Zambezi River

Elephants play soccer in Nepal Festival
That was a part of an elephant-themed festival in Nepal, an event held to promote conservation awareness and lure foreign visitors to Nepal
